Stanford Financial Hosts First Tee of the Triad…

Piedmont Triad Boys and Girls attend the Wyndham Championship

GREENSBORO, N.C. – The First Tee of the Triad and Stanford Financial Group are teaming up to bring 40 boys and girls from First Tee of the Triad to the Wyndham Championship free of charge. The 69th annual Wyndham Championship is set for Aug. 11-17, 2008.

First Tee of the Triad is a non-profit organization whose mission statement is to impact the lives of young people by providing the facilities and educational programs that promote character development and life-enhancing values through the game of golf. A $125 annual fee covers expenses associated with use of the golf courses, the learning center and entrance into the First Tee Life Skills program. However, scholarships are available; no child is turned away due to financial need.

Stanford Financial Group will entertain clients at its luxury suite on the par-four 17th hole at Sedgefield Country Club during the PGA TOUR event, but on Thursday and Friday of tournament week, it will be occupied by children participating in activities sponsored by First Tee of the Triad. The young golf fans will be accompanied by 10 chaperones.

“We are delighted to host the First Tee youth at Stanford’s Wyndham Championship suite on Thursday and Friday of tournament week,” Eddie Rollins, Executive Director of the Carolinas for Stanford said. “These children have shown great enthusiasm for the game of golf and experiencing firsthand a PGA Tour event will only increase their excitement and interest in the sport. First Tee is a fantastic program and does an amazing job, not only teaching these children the game of golf, but the life-skills associated with it, such as honesty, integrity, and perseverance.”

The First Tee vision is to teach The First Tee Nine Core Valuesâ„¢ in hopes of touching the lives of young people in the community: integrity, sportsmanship, respect, confidence, responsibility, perseverance, courtesy, judgment and honesty. First Tee uses golf as the vehicle through which kids can accomplish their dreams, thrive socially, excel academically and athletically. Young people from all backgrounds can become productive members of society with integrity, strong family values and commitment to community.

“I can’t imagine a better way for some of our First Tee friends to experience the Wyndham Championship than in a luxury suite behind the 17th green,” tournament director Mark Brazil said. “Our new partnership with Stanford is great for the Wyndham Championship, and the growth of First Tee of the Triad is extremely positive for the Piedmont Triad. We would like thank Stanford for providing this opportunity for these young golf fans.”
